Today I will show you all the steps to make your very own Traveling Thread Catcher. Let’s start with what you need: 1 Fabric Rectangle: 8 x 9.75” 2 Fabric Circles: 3 ½“ diameter (across) 2 Card board Circles: 2 ¾” diameter (Use lightweight cardboard. I used a soda can box) 2 Batting Circles: 2 ¾” diameter 1 Pringles Circle: 1/2” wide *If you are looking to make multiples for gifts, you can get three thread catcher from one fat quarter* I like to put masking tape on the Pringles circle, covers the edges and also keeps the Informacion Nutricional from showing through light colored fabric! The easiest way to trace your batting and cardboard circles is to use the inside Pringles ring! 1. Do a running stitch around the edge of fabric circle. 2. Place batting then cardboard in center of fabric circle, pull up stitching to gather around, secure with a knot. 3. Do this twice. 4. Sew two circle sets together, wrong sides together. 5.
